I'm running OS X 10.10.4 on a Macbook Pro Retina. After downloading and installing Batchphoto 3.7.1 (the version I'm licensed for), nothing happens when I run the app. No windows appear and no activity is detected. Nothing.

I've rebooted, uninstalled and reinstalled the app numerous times. Same result.

FWIW, I can install and run the latest version without problems.

Due to changes made by Apple in OS X Yosemite (10.10), older versions of BatchPhoto are not supported by this new operating system. However older versions of BatchPhoto still work on Mavericks, Mountain Lion, and Lion.

The latest update of BatchPhoto (4.0.2) works without problems on Yosemite. You can download and install the trial from here:
